I'm trying to plot a Pareto curve in a multiobjective optimisation (using gaplotpareto) but the resultant curve has some plot points that are non-pareto optimal (see image). Is this a bug or why are non-Pareto optimal plot points included?
The only options I'm setting are the plot options and the only constraints are lower and upper bounds for the solution variables.
opts = gaoptimset('PlotFcns',{@gaplotpareto,@gaplotscorediversity});
[optimal_sol, optimal_fitness, exitFlag, Output] = gamultiobj(fitnessFun, num_vars,[],[],[],[], lower_bounds, upper_bounds, opts);

If there were non-linear constraints, the solver may accept some dominated points if they are feasible. However, in your case, the entire population should be feasible so this is a bug.
